c++中trim的作用有哪些

c++
367
2024/4/29 10:29:43
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在C++中,"trim"通常是指从字符串的开头和结尾删除空格和其他空白字符的操作。trim操作有以下几个作用:

  1. 删除字符串开头和结尾的空格、制表符、换行符等空白字符,使得字符串更加整洁和易读。
  2. 去除用户输入时可能误输入的额外空格,避免因为空格导致的格式不一致或比对错误。
  3. 处理从文件或网络中读取的字符串时,去除可能存在的多余空格,便于后续的处理和解析。
  4. 在字符串比对或搜索时,保证字符串的内容一致,避免因为空格的存在导致比对失败。
  5. 在处理用户输入时,去除首尾空格可以减少因为用户输入错误而导致的问题,提高程序的容错性。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: c++中strncpy函数的作用是什么